Item 5.05 Amendments to the Registrant's Code of Ethics, or Waiver of a Provision of the Code of Ethics

On August 10, 2011, the Board of Directors of Healthways, Inc. (the “Company”), approved amendments to the Company’s Code of Business Conduct (the “Code of Conduct”), which applies to all directors, officers and employees of the Company. The Code of Conduct was amended to, among other things, enhance the description of policies and procedures related to anti-corruption; present more prominent management support for all topics within the Code of Conduct; update the Company’s modified approach to enterprise risk management; update content based on changes in laws, rules and regulations within jurisdictions in which the Company does business; and streamline sources of guidance and reporting mechanisms for the Company’s employees. The foregoing summary of the amendments to the Code of Conduct is subject to and q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Code of Conduct, as so amended, a copy of which is attached as Exhibit 14.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and which is incorporated by reference into this Item 5.05. The Code of Conduct is available in the Investors section of the Company’s website at http://www.healthways.com.
